In March of this year, for the first time, a species of bumble bee was declared endangered by the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service. The Rusty Patched Bumble Bee, once abundant in 28 U.S. states and two Canadian provinces, has seen its numbers drop nearly 90% since the 1990s and is now in danger of … Continue reading 100 Word Challenge: Honey
